MAJORITY has two membership plans: Base and Plus. Every member is on one of these two plans, and the features, fees, and access to certain services depend on the plan. The Base plan is free, but some services have usage fees. The Plus plan costs $6.99 every 30 days.
Features available on both plans:
The sign-up process is the same for both
Axiom Bank bank account
MAJORITY Pay: Send and request money between MAJORITY US members, send money to MAJORITY Wallet members, and send money to non-members outside the United States (the recipient gets an invitation link and must become a member to receive the money).
Phone plans (same rates for both membership plans)
In-app chat with customer service
Options to add money: Both plans can add money to their account via bank deposit, card deposit, cash deposit, and direct deposit.
Features available with the Plus plan:
MAJORITY Visa® debit card, digital and physical
Pockets
Credit card, with application available from the app
Cashback
Free international calls to more than 35 countries
International transfers to a bank account with no transfer fee
MAJORITY Pay to non-members in the United States
International top-ups with no fee
Additional ways to add money, such as ATM deposits, check deposits, payment app, and payment link
Phone support
None of these features are available on the Base plan.
Fees per service - Base plan
The Base plan has no monthly membership fee, but some services have a cost.
International transfers:
$1.99 per international transfer.
If the recipient withdraws the money in cash, $3 is charged.
International top-ups:
$0.99 per top-up.
International calls:
A per-minute rate is charged that varies by country.
The Plus plan does not have these fees for international top-ups, international calls, or international bank-account transfers. However, an international transfer requested for cash pickup has a cost of $3.
